As a method to remind people of a famous person or events, memorial landscape has a very long history. From the start of Primitive Art and Religious Art, memorial place always brought human psychological a sense of seriousness, tension, Permanence and constriction. Manifestations on the design, it is the unaltered axis mode of space. Until the Roosevelt Memorial designed by Lawrence Halprin after world war, contemporary memorial landscape design gradually shows a closer attention to the context of the site, through the design to express the backstories of event and the experience and feelings of visitors in the place of memorial landscape.This thesis starts from the relation between memorial landscape and place theory, through the influence factors in site, design to express the event and place experience-making to make the transform from site to place. And then make a comparison between Roosevelt Memorial and Roosevelt Four Freedoms Park to analysis how the designers to make the conversion from the general site into a place of memorial atmosphere landscape when faces the different site context. In the end, hope this place-making analysis of contemporary western memorial landscape design, may bring a revelation for our country’s memorial landscape design.
